    Observe the following when working on tem. this system: Replace faulty components only ■ National installation requirements with original Viessmann spare ■ Legal instructions regarding the pre- parts. vention of accidents ■ Legal instructions regarding environ- mental protection ■...
  • Page 3 Installing non-author- ised components and making non-approved modifications or conversions can compromise safety and may invalidate our warranty. For replacements, use only orig- inal spare parts supplied or approved by Viessmann.

    Certificates Declaration of conformity We, Viessmann Werke GmbH&Co KG, D-35107 Allendorf, declare as sole respon- sible body that the product Vitoladens 300-T complies with the following standards: EN 267 EN 303 EN 15 034 EN 15 035 (for balanced flue operation)
